我有一个嵌套在外部表格内的 html 表。
<table border="1">
<tr>
<td>
<canvas id="myCanvas" width="100" height="100" style="border:1px solid #FF0000;"/>
</td>
<td>
<table border="1" >
<tr>
<td>A</td>
<td>B</td>
<td>C</td>
</tr>
</table>
</td>
</tr>
</table>
Run Code Online (Sandbox Code Playgroud)
我想要的是内部表格高度扩展以匹配外部表格行的高度。我尝试使用 height:100% 的样式设置内表,正如我在其他地方看到的建议,但它不起作用:
https://jsfiddle.net/twistedlizard/ghnyton9/
谁能告诉我技术吗?
您应该设置height为父元素。
<table border="1">
<tr>
<td>
<canvas id="myCanvas" width="100" height="100" style="border:1px solid #FF0000;"/>
</td>
<td style="padding: 0; height:100%">
<table border="1" style="height:100%;">
<tr>
<td>A</td>
<td>B</td>
<td>C</td>
</tr>
</table>
</td>
</tr>
</table>
Run Code Online (Sandbox Code Playgroud)